> ENVIRONMENT
> =====================
> XenServer Version : 6.2
> ISSUE
> ==================
> Disabled Host Keeps Being 'UP' status after unmanging cluster
> Repro. steps followed
> ==================
> Disabled Host from UI.
> Unmanaged the cluster which the host was in.
> Still can see the Host showing 'UP' in UI
> Expected Behavior
> ===============
> After disabling the host and un-managing the cluster, the host should appear in "disconnected" state and not UP state.
